#### **Cons:**1. **Cost** While generally more affordable than OEM parts, this compressor may still be pricier than generic or lower-end aftermarket alternatives. The price reflects its quality and reliability.
2. **Compatibility Risks** If installed in a system not originally designed for this compressor (e.g., a non-Denso OEM system or an aftermarket setup with mismatched components), performance issues or premature failure could occur. Always verify compatibility with refrigerant type (e.g., R-134a, R-1234yf) and system specifications.
3. **Installation Complexity** Replacing a compressor requires proper evacuation of the system, refrigerant recharging, and leak testing. Improper installation can lead to system failure or void warranty coverage. Professional installation is recommended.
4. **Limited Availability of Replacement Parts** While Denso compressors are durable, if the unit fails, finding replacement parts (e.g., seals, valves) may be more difficult than with more common brands.
5. **Potential for Counterfeit Parts** Purchasing from untrusted sellers increases the risk of receiving a counterfeit or low-quality knockoff. Always buy from reputable suppliers (e.g., RockAuto, Denso-authorized dealers, or trusted local auto parts stores).
6. **Refrigerant Compatibility** Some older Denso compressors may not be compatible with newer refrigerants (e.g., R-1234yf). Always confirm the correct refrigerant type for your application to avoid damage or inefficiency.
